As a pioneer in healthcare, Manipal Hospitals is among the top healthcare providers in India serving over 5 million patients annually.

Today we stand as an integrated network with a pan-India footprint of 33 hospitals across 17 cities with 9,500 beds, and a talented pool of over 5,000 doctors and an employee strength of over 20,000.


Manipal Hospitals is NABH, AAHRPP accredited and most of the hospitals in its network are NABL, ER, Blood Bank accredited and recognized for Nursing Excellence.

Job Summary:


  • Provide endtoend comprehensive care for patients assigned.
  • Takes the nursing history, summarizes data, and states nursing diagnoses/ patient care needs.
  • Observes and records signs, symptoms, and behaviours, including the physiological status of patients; reports assessment changes, to the concerned authority.
  • Follows policy and delivers designated nursing interventions to assigned patients that are consistent with the stated medical plan of care.
  • Performs admission, discharge and transfer procedures, and assists others with patient's activities and care.
  • Executes physician's orders for all assigned patients; safely and properly administers medications and treatments.
  • To be responsible for collection of specimens when ordered, ensuring correct labelling.
  • To be responsible for preparing assigned patients for programmed medical procedures.
  • To participate in specialists rounds and assist by giving relevant information as regards to nursing observations made on the residents.
  • To supervise the cleanliness of assigned area or the ward.
  • Carry out routine check at each handover that all equipments are in working order.
  • To ensure that all items used for residents inclusive of medications, surgical supplies are duly recorded and charged.
  • To carry out inventory on surgical items and equipment for each week.
  • Maintain residents safety by taking preventive measures against accidents.
  • Accurately records and reports incidents.
  • Provide information regarding posttreatment homecare needs, including diet and nutrition and exercise programs.
  • Record all nursing care information in a precise and accurate manner and by following appropriate formats and forms.
